프로그래밍 QnA + 설치 및 활용 QnA + 질문

eminency의 이미지

mysql 원격 접속

서버 두 대가 있고... 한 쪽에서 다른 쪽의 mysql DB에 접속하려고 하는데요. 물론 mysql은 양쪽 모두 설치되어 있습니다.
근데 어떻게 접속하는 거지요? -_-;

mysql에 -h옵션을 주어도 안되고... mysqlaccess를 이용하는 건지...?

waltherppk의 이미지

C로 자료구조/알고리즘 공부하려고 하는데요

책은 오라일리의 "Algorithm with C" 번역판을 택했는데요
자료구조를 어떻게 구현한다는 것은 대충 알 것도 같은데
어떻게 사용하는 것인지는 그림이 안그려지네요.
좀더 예제가 많은 책이나 사이트 없을까요 ?

Java만 갖고 흔들어대다가, C도 알아야할 것 같아서 시작했는데요
Java에서는 컬렉션 객체를 생성해서 집어넣으면 되었는데
C에서는 그런게 아니니까 좀 혼란스럽습니다.

자료구조 헤더파일을 여러군데서 include하면 각각 따로 관리 되나요 ?
그리고

kerry74의 이미지

export/import 하는 방법 좀 가르켜 주세요.

공유 DLL 을 하나 만들었는데요.

DLL 에서 로딩하는 쪽의 변수나 함수를 쓰고 싶습니다.
변수나 함수를 export 하고 dll 에서 import 하면 사용할 수 있을것 같은데
어떻게 하는지 문법이나 자세한 설명을 찾을 수가 없네요.

아시는 분 부탁 드립니다.

qprk의 이미지

프로그램 컴파일시 Common.h:1: warning: carriage return in pr

[code:1]
[ㅌㅌㅌ@ㅂㅂㅂ multi_robot]$ make
make exec1
make[1]: 들어감 `/home/qprk/raid1/qprk/200101/project/multi_robot' 디렉토리
gcc -pedantic -Wall -c -o htmlparser.o htmlparser.c
htmlparser.c:9: warning: carriage return in preprocessing directive
In file included from htmlparser.c:9:
Common.h:1: warning: carriage return in preprocessing directive
In file included from htmlparser.c:9:
Common.h:2: warning: carriage return in preprocessing directive
In file included from htmlparser.c:9:
Common.h:3: warning: carriage return in preprocessing directive

powerice의 이미지

grub에서 splash.xpm.gz 파일을 수정할 수 있습니까?

splash.xpm.gz 이미지파일 같은데 확장자도 틀리고,,

다른 그림파일을 .xpm.gz 형식으로 변환 할 수 있습니까?

변환 할 수 있다면 jpg도 가능한지 알고 싶습니다. ^^

penpen의 이미지

리눅스 배포판마다 성능 차이가 있나요?

리눅스 보니 대략 슬랙웨어와 데비안, 레드햇이 유명하고.

각 배포판마다 정책이 조금씩 다르더군요. 각 배포판이 성능 차이가 있나요? 커널은 같을테니 큰 차이가 없다고 생각되는데, 어떤 선배께서 리눅스는 배포판이 너무 많아서 한 곳에서 관리하는 freebsd를 권한다고 하길래 문득 저런 궁금증이..^^;

mushim의 이미지

PTHREAD_MUTEX_INITIALIZER 사용법에 대해서..

pthread_mutex_t mymutex=PTHREAD_MUTEX_INITIALIZER;

이런 식으로 mutex 를 초기화 하는것은 상관없는 데,

mymutex=PTHREAD_MUTEX_INITIALIZER;

다시 초기화를 하기 위해서 위와 같이 하면 parse error 를 내어 버리네요.

찾아보니, /usr/include/pthread.h 에서 아래와 같이 정의되어 있더군요.

#define PTHREAD_MUTEX_INITIALIZER \
  {0, 0, 0, PTHREAD_MUTEX_TIMED_NP, __LOCK_INITIALIZER}

한번 선언된 mutex 를 PTHREAD_MUTEX_INITIALIZER 를 이용해서 초기화 할 수 없

moonzoo의 이미지

HEADER 파일에서...

curses.h라는 파일을 include 하였는데..

curses.h
...
#ifdef _XOPEN_SOURCE_EXTENDED
...
#define ACS_VLINE   ACS_SBSB
..
.
#endif

여기서 ACS_VLINE를 사용하고 싶은데..

소스에서 그걸 쓰면

ACS_VLINE undefined... 라는 error가 발생합니다.

어떻게 하면 위에 ACS_VLINE를 사용할 수 있을지

궁금합니다.

참고로 컴파일 할때 -lcurses 는 하였습니다.

zzsay의 이미지

텔넷 또는 ssh 에서 파일 올리는법???

rz sz 로 다운로드 가능 하다고 하는대요

전 zterm 이라는 텔넷 터미널 쓰고 있습니다.

그래서 계정 접속후 sz files.tar 하면 무슨 숫자 000000sSSSD00

이런식으로 나오고 아무런 현상도 안일어 납니다.

그리고 쉘이 멈추어서 장시간 아무것도 안대요.
왜 그런거죠?

rz 하고 업로드할 파일명 해도 마찬가지더라구요

낙엽의 이미지

pthread_mutex_lock에서..

program 로직상 처음 사용하는곳에서 segment fault가 나네요.

컴파일시는 전혀 에러도 없구요.

dbx로 찍어보니 단순히 pthread_mutex_lock에서 걸렸다는 것만 표시되네요.

혹시 프로그램 상에서 최초로 pthread_mutex_lock 걸다가 segment fault 난 경우 당해보신분 계세요?

페이지

프로그래밍 QnA + 설치 및 활용 QnA + 질문 구독하기